Ok, _release list_del_init qcan't race with that because it happens in exit_mmap when no other mmu notifier can trigger anymore. _unregister can run concurrently but it does list_del_rcu, that only overwrites the pprev pointer with LIST_POISON2. The mmu_notifier_invalidate_range_start won't crash on LIST_POISON1 thanks to srcu. Actually I did more changes than necessary, for example I noticed the mmu_notifier_register can return a list_add_head instead of list_add_head_rcu. _register can't race against _release thanks to the mm_users temporary or implicit pin. _register can't race against _unregister thanks to the mmu_notifier_mm->lock. And register can't race against all other mmu notifiers thanks to the mm_lock. At this time I've no other pending patches on top of v14-pre3 other than the below micro-optimizing cleanup.
